Drive a bunch of them and be very very picky. There's a bunch for sale and the prices on used boxsters are set at sublime and ridiculous levels and everything in between. There's no rhyme or rhythm for it as far as I can tell.

You will never regret buying the newest, lowest mileage S you can find. The larger engine and the glass rear window in the 03's and up makes all the difference in the world, I assure you.
